A Day in the Life of President Bush - (photos) - 8.22.06
Whitehouse.gov, Yahoo.com; Reuters | 8.22.06 | ohioWfan

Posted on 08/22/2006 5:09:45 PM PDT by ohioWfan

After calling President Karzai of Afghanistan to discuss security measures and a potential visit, President Bush left the White House early this afternoon to go to Minnesota. In Minnetonka, he participated in a panel discussion on health care, and also signed an Executive Order to help increase the transparency of America's health care system - empowering Americans to find better value and better care. The order will require various federal agencies to compile information about the quality and price of health care they pay for, and share that information with their customers and each other. The White House website has posted a FACT SHEET about this order.

The President also attended a fundraiser for Minnesota Congressional Candidate, State Senator Michele Bachman after the panel discussion, and stopped for a frozen custard in Wayzata.

We're going to have an interesting dialogue today. I'm going the sign an executive order after a while, but I want to explain why we're signing the executive order to you. We've got an interesting debate in health care in America. And I guess if I had to summarize how I view it, I would say there's a choice between having the government make decisions or consumers make decisions. I stand on the side of encouraging consumers. I think the most important relationship in health care is between the patient and their provider, the patient and the doc. (Applause.) Thank you. And health care policy ought to be aimed at bolstering the consumer, empowering individuals to be responsible for health care decisions -- is kind of the crux about what we're talking about.
